Understanding the Importance of a Sample Letter To Conduct Research

A well-crafted “Sample Letter To Conduct Research” is crucial for several reasons. First, it helps you present yourself and your research professionally. It shows the recipient that you’ve put thought and effort into your request. Secondly, it clearly outlines your research goals, ensuring the recipient understands what you’re asking for. This clarity increases the likelihood of a positive response. Finally, a good letter establishes trust and respect.

Consider the following points when composing your letter:

  • Clarity: Be very clear about the purpose of your research.
  • Professionalism: Use a respectful and formal tone.
  • Specifics: Mention exactly what information you are seeking.

A well-written letter significantly increases the chances of your research request being approved and the information being provided. Think of it as your first chance to impress someone and get them on board with your project. Remember, politeness and a clear explanation go a long way!

Requesting Access to Data or Records

Subject: Data Access Request – [Your Research Topic]

Dear [Contact Person/Organization],

My name is [Your Name], and I am [Your Title/Student] at [Your School/Organization]. I am conducting research on [Your Research Topic] and require access to [Specific Data or Records].

My research aims to [Explain the purpose of your research and why you need the data]. I understand the importance of data privacy and confidentiality and assure you that all data will be used solely for research purposes and handled according to [Mention any relevant ethical guidelines or data protection policies]. I am committed to protecting the privacy of any individuals involved.

I would like to request access to [Specify the data or records you need, e.g., specific reports, datasets, or historical records]. I am flexible with the format and the method of data access, and I am open to complying with any requirements you may have for the use of this data. I would be very grateful if you could inform me of the requirements or conditions for accessing the data.

Thank you for your consideration. I look forward to hearing from you soon.

Sincerely,

[Your Name]

[Your Contact Information]
